About Protocol Behavioral Health

Protocol provides cancer-specific behavioral health treatment to patients by partnering with oncology clinics and cancer centers. Oncology patients are at heightened risk of mental health disorders and suicide, and those conditions negatively impact patient outcomes, treatment adherence, and total cost of care. Our approach is designed to meet patients where they are—emotionally, logistically, and financially. We deliver high-quality mental health support for cancer patients using the collaborative care model, integrated directly into oncology treatment centers.

About the role

The Lead Behavioral Health Care Manager is an experienced, licensed Behavioral Healthcare Manager (BHCM) responsible for clinical supervision and management of a team of BHCMs, as well as delivering some direct patient care. You will collaborate with clinical leadership to support clinical supervision for evidence-based treatments delivered via the Collaborative Care Model (CoCM) to cancer patients. The best candidate for this role is data-driven and outcomes-focused who understands how to bring out the highest quality work in their team.

What you will be doing

Lead a team of BHCMs with the following responsibilities (60% of your time):

  • Provide training as needed to BHCMs to deliver evidence-based treatments to cancer patients

  • Review BHCM sessions for quality assessments and provide feedback to BHCMs for improvement

  • Track KPIs of BHCMs and support them in achieving targets, such as timely completion of documentation

  • Conduct audits of session notes to ensure compliant documentation

  • Proactively identify challenges for BHCMs and identify solutions in collaboration with clinical leadership

  • Participate in rotating business hours on-call for patient safety concerns and risk-assessments

  • Evaluate BHCMs job performance and develop improvement plans as needed

Conduct direct patient care via Collaborative Care Model (40% of your time), which includes:

  • Conduct structured assessments of mental and behavioral health and functioning of oncology patients referred by partner cancer centers and clinics.

  • Develop treatment plans based on assessment results using Protocol’s evidence-based modular treatment approach.

  • Implement treatment modules and conduct ongoing progress assessment to guide next steps in care and make changes as indicated by patient progress.

  • In accordance CoCM, maintain a patient registry, participate in weekly consultations with psychiatrist, and communicate & collaborate with oncology teams about patient progress and recommendations

  • Maintain licensure in home state and obtain licensure in other states as requested by Protocol (licensure costs will be covered by Protocol).

  • Perform other duties as assigned.

What we are looking for

  • Licensed mental health providers with 2+ years experience treating patients with chronic/serious medical illness

  • 1+ years of experience leading a team. A plus if experience managing a remote team across multiple states

  • Consistent use of data to support decision-making

  • Strong skills in communication and working on diverse teams

  • Ability to balance business needs with clinical priorities

  • Comfort in a fast-paced environment with frequent change

  • Ability to support a caseload of patients of different diagnoses, backgrounds and cultures, and with varying degrees of acuity.

  • Ability to deliver care in a virtual setting.

  • Experience supporting patients with suicidal ideation and/or trauma.
